zoukankan      html  css  js  c++  java
  • 学习笔记之pip的基本使用

    粗略学习了pip的基础知识,便将此作为学习笔记记录下来同样希望分享的能帮到大家!

    如果自己电脑没有pip,小澈在此分享如何安装,解决办法很多呢

    1、使用easy_install安装: 各种进入到easy_install脚本的目录下,然后运行easy_inatall pip

    2、使用get-pip.py安装: 在下面的url下载get-pip.py脚本 curl https://bootstrap.pypa.io/get-pip.py -o get-pip.py 然后运行:python get-pip.py 这个脚本会同时安装setuptools和wheel工具。

    3、在linux下使用包管理工具安装pip: 例如,ubuntu下:sudo apt-get install python-pip。Fedora系下:sudo yum install python-pip

    4、在windows下安装pip: 在C:python27scirpts下运行easy_install pip进行安装。
    刚安装完毕的pip可能需要先升级一下自身: 在Linux或masOS中:pip install -U pip 在windows中:python -m pip install -U pip

    一、基础使用

    1、在命令行下,输入pip,回车可以看到帮助说明:
    在这里插入图片描述
    2、以安装pillow模块为例。输入pip install pillow(我经过了换源),安装过程如下图
    在这里插入图片描述

    命令集锦

    3、 指定版本安装
    安装特定版本的package,通过使用==, >=, <=, >, <来指定一个版本号。 pip install ‘Markdown<2.0’ pip install 'Markdown>2.0,<2.0.3

    4、卸载已安装的库
    pip uninstall pillow

    5、 列出已经安装的库
    pip list

    6、 将已经安装的库列表保存到文本文件中
    pip freeze > requirements.txt

    这个功能非常常用、好用!经常被用作项目环境依赖文件。

    7、 根据依赖文件批量安装库
    pip install -r requirements.txt

    使用上面的txt文件,批量安装第三方库。

    8、使用wheel文件安装
    除了使用上面的方式联网进行安装外,还可以将安装包也就是wheel格式的文件,下载到本地,然后使用pip进行安装。比如我在PYPI上提前下载的pillow库的wheel文件,后缀名为whl。

    可以使用pip install pillow-x.xxxxxxxx.whl的方式离线进行安装

    9、pip源的选择
    很多时候,比如网络不给力,连接超时、防火墙阻挡等等各种原因,我们可能无法从Python官方的PyPi仓库进行pip安装,这时候可以选择国内的第三方源,推荐使用豆瓣源,速度不错。

    总结:
    pip 是目前 python 包管理的事实标准,2008年发布。它被用作 easy_install 的替代品,但是它仍有大量的功能建立在 setuptools 组件之上。具有十分大的优势,值得朋友们去学习。

  • 相关阅读:
    加法问题,编程入门课
    三.Python变量,常量,注释
    二、python介绍
    一. python 安装
    Syntax behind sorted(key=lambda :)
    Java动态数组
    Package name does not correspond to the file path (IntelliJ IDEA)
    理解Java构造器中的"this"
    The Constructor with No Arguments
    160229-01、web页面常用功能js实现
  • 原文地址:https://www.cnblogs.com/dufu-csdn/p/dufu_9.html
Copyright © 2011-2022 走看看